Bismarck ( NDDEQ) The North Dakota Department of Environmental Quality is advising individuals with respiratory conditions or other health problems to limit outdoor activities.

BISMARCK, N.D. (AP) — A proposed North Dakota wind farm is being moved to another part of the state after a new developer bought out the project.

(NJ.com) More than 62,000 pounds of raw beef has been recalled over possible E. coli contamination, days ahead of Memorial Day weekend.
